Are temporary and permanent carbon stores interchangeable?

Robert Höglund on marginalcarbon.substack.com, Feb 7

„Are three trees worth one rock? Permanent storage is always best, but given realistic assumptions on discounting of future damages, as well as long-term climate adaptation – carbon storage lasting centuries could be made comparable to permanent storage. However, carbon re-released before peak warming needs to be replaced and cannot be equalized to permanent CDR.“
